Transaction e77e53aee67a7eb9a77a97acd9affc9497d03644a68783cbfcebec0c866a5f36
1 Input
1 Output
-
e77e53aee67a7eb9a77a97acd9affc9497d03644a68783cbfcebec0c866a5f36:0
- value
- 190584
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cb58cf8cc7cf24ae33fb694332dd447e92c79e3e OP_EQUAL
- address
- 3LEDVATTh1K633SPcyDEBH6EVwAWipc6VN